Lack of Power/Sluggish/Spongy


SYMPTOM DESCRIPTION:
Engine delivers less than expected power. Little or no increase in speed when accelerator is pushed down part way. Check the following systems.



COMPUTER INPUTS/OUTPUTS
^ EFI control unit grounds for electrical integrity.
^ AIR FLOW METER: Stuck or sluggish flap.
^ OXYGEN SENSOR:



FUEL
^ FUEL PRESSURE: Check delivery pressure and volume output.
^ FUEL INJECTORS: Check spray pattern, clogged or stuck.
^ CONTAMINATED FUEL:
^ RESTRICTED FUEL FILTER:




IGNITION
^ Proper ignition voltage output.



EXHAUST
^ RESTRICTION:
1. With engine at normal operating temperature, connect a vacuum gauge to any convenient vacuum port on intake manifold.
2. Run engine at 1000 rpm and record vacuum reading.
3. Increase rpm slowly to 2500 rpm. Note vacuum reading at a steady 2500 rpm.
4. If vacuum at 2500 rpm decreases more than 3" Hg, from reading at 1000 rpm, the exhaust system should be inspected for restrictions.
5. Disconnect exhaust pipe from engine and repeat Step 3 & 4. If vacuum still drops more than 3" Hg, with exhaust disconnected, check for exhaust manifold restriction and valve timing



ENGINE/TRANSMISSION
^ BATTERY VOLTAGE: Check battery voltage and alternator output.
^ A/C operation.
^ ENGINE COMPRESSION;
^ ENGINE VALVE TIMING:
^ ENGINE CAMSHAFT for wear and proper application.
^ TORQUE CONVERTER CLUTCH: Check operation.
^ TRANSMISSION SHIFT POINTS:
